Growing consumer awareness around sustainable seafood certification
The results of a survey commisioned by the Marine Stewardship Council reveals that seafood consumers are increasingly demanding independent verification of sustainability claims in supermarkets. Research agency GlobeScan surveyed more than 25,000 consumers in 22 countries, and 72% of this year's respondents expressed a desire for such independent certification, up from 68% in 2016. 11 Oct 2018

IBM Food Trust launches worldwide with Carrefour on board
European retail giant Carrefour has joined other participants involved in building the IBM Food Trust blockchain network, adopting the technology to improve the traceability of food products with plans to expand to all Carrefour brands by 2022. 11 Oct 2018
